When you're outfitting an RV, camper van, or any mobile living space for year‑round comfort, the thermostat becomes a central control point. The right device should offer precise temperature regulation, straightforward scheduling, and dependable performance across fluctuating power sources. Look for models with digital displays, backlighting for nighttime visibility, and clear thermostat algorithms that minimize abrupt temperature swings. Consider compatibility with auxiliary heightens like heat pumps or built-in electric heaters, and ensure the unit can be controlled remotely via a smartphone app. A robust travel thermostat also needs solid surge protection and weatherproofing if you’ll be using it in outdoor or semi‑exposed garages, porches, or sheds.
Beyond core temperature control, your choice should account for the realities of mobile living. Power availability often shifts between generator, shore power, and battery banks, so select a device that gracefully shifts between sources without creating a drain. Energy efficiency matters because every watt matters during long trips or in off‑grid setups. A compact unit with low standby power consumption preserves your battery reserve for lighting and essential devices. Look for models that provide energy‑saving modes, adaptive hold settings, and easy manual overrides when you need rapid changes. Examine the installation footprint, venting requirements, and whether the thermostat includes universal mounting plates that fit common RV wall spaces.
Optimize performance with thoughtful power and sensor features.
A high‑quality travel thermostat should be designed for vibrations, temperature extremes, and variable electrical environments. When evaluating, check for a durable housing that resists moisture and dust intrusion, along with sealed buttons that won’t stick after exposure to minor splashes or spray from the galley sink. User experience matters, too: tactile controls, intuitive menus, and a logically organized app layout reduce adjustment time at rest stops. Compatibility with smart home ecosystems can add convenience, letting you adjust climate from a tablet or phone. Additionally, verify that the device can log performance, so you can review trends and optimize settings for comfort and energy savings.

Installation is a key practical detail, especially if you’re moving between rigs or frequently swapping vehicles. Favor single‑box solutions that don’t require extensive rewiring or specialized tools. Many compact travel thermostats are designed for simple wall mounting with standard HVAC mounting patterns, and some offer plug‑in power adapters that simplify power sourcing on the road. If you need integration with existing thermostats or zoning controllers, confirm compatibility before purchase. Read the included instructions for mounting height and reach to ensure the display remains legible from your preferred seating or sleeping area. A concise quick‑start guide saves time after long drives when you’re tired but still want climate control.
Durability, safety, and reliability influence long‑term value.
When considering sensors, prioritize units with accurate ambient sensing, responsive actuators, and fast recovery from setpoint changes. A dependable device should quickly adjust to outdoor temperature shifts, especially during sudden weather fronts. Temperature probes placed away from direct sun exposure or heat sources like ovens will yield more stable readings. Some models incorporate multiple sensors around the vehicle to balance zones, providing uniform comfort without overcooling a single area. Look for devices that support adaptive temperature compensation, which helps preserve battery life by avoiding unnecessary cooling or heating when the RV is unoccupied for extended periods.

Connectivity expands the usefulness of a portable climate system. Many compact thermostats offer app ecosystems that deliver remote control, schedule automation, and alert notifications for maintenance or power issues. Ensure the app supports secure login, offline functionality, and straightforward firmware updates. A unit that communicates through widely adopted protocols (like Wi‑Fi, Bluetooth, or Zigbee) gives you more installation flexibility and future upgrade paths. If you travel in regions with intermittent cellular service, choose a model that can operate offline and sync data when a connection returns. This resilience reduces the risk of climate mismanagement when cellular networks are spotty.
Fit, form, and compatibility with your vehicle’s climate plan.
Durable devices withstand the bumps of travel and the occasional spray from a kitchen faucet during chilly mornings. Check for IP ratings indicating water and dust resistance, especially if your rig is stored outdoors or in damp environments. A robust thermostat should have temperature protection against overheating, voltage spikes, and incorrect wiring that could damage sensitive electronics. Safety features such as audible alarms for sensor failure or auto‑shutoff during extreme conditions reduce the risk of overheating or freezing. Additionally, look for certifications or compliance with regional electrical standards to ensure safe operation in your area and ease of insurance claims.
Warranty coverage and customer support are often overlooked until trouble arises. A generous warranty demonstrates confidence in build quality, and responsive support helps when you encounter firmware glitches or installation questions on the road. Read the fine print to understand what is covered, whether repair means sending a part back to the manufacturer, and if there are reasonable labor terms. Favor brands that maintain a clear knowledge base, provide diagnostic guides, and offer live chat or phone access. If possible, choose a vendor with a track record of quick replacements for defective units, minimizing downtime during critical travel seasons or extreme weather.

The form factor of a compact travel thermostat should align with your vehicle’s interior layout and mounting options. Some units are slim enough to nestle beside a control panel, while others mount over existing openings with standard screws. Check the overall footprint to ensure it doesn’t crowd switches, USB hubs, or charging docks. For RVs with multiple zones, consider a modular approach where separate thermostats control different areas yet share a single app interface or hub. This setup can simplify management and enable tailored comfort in sleeping areas, living zones, and workspaces without paying for unnecessary extra features.
In addition to a small footprint, the device should support straightforward calibration and maintenance. A manufacturer‑provided guide for initial setup helps you avoid misconfigurations that cause uncomfortable temperature swings. Tools or simple step‑by‑step procedures for sensor recalibration can keep readings accurate over time, especially after long trips. Regular firmware updates are beneficial, but ensure the process is reliable and non‑disruptive, so you don’t lose climate control during a download. Also, verify that replacement parts and service are readily available in case components wear out after heavy use.
To choose wisely, start by outlining your power plan, preferred control style, and installation constraints. List must‑have features such as remote control, multi‑zone support, or energy‑saving modes, then rate each unit against those criteria. Read independent reviews that highlight long‑term reliability rather than quick performance after unboxing. If possible, view demonstration videos that show the thermostat in action across different climates and vehicle configurations. Consider budgeting for extras like a dedicated mounting kit, anti‑backlash screws, or a weatherproof enclosure, all of which can extend life and maintain performance in variable field conditions.
Finally, test your top choices in a controlled setting before your next departure. A trial run allows you to verify app connectivity, setpoint accuracy, and response times under both hot and cold conditions. Observe how the device performs when the vehicle is idle for extended periods, when solar input fluctuates, and when generator power cycles on and off. If you notice any lag, buzzing, or screen inconsistencies, consult the manufacturer’s support resources or pursue a warranty replacement. With deliberate selection and careful setup, your compact travel thermostat becomes a dependable companion for comfortable, energy‑efficient mobile living.
